Output 89a2cce59ad2091ffe44a8639b4da15b456eddff696e2f97833af34e0ef4af4f:7

value
67180654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1a35e9f48eccb0649c32c8be11736f0965091e7 OP_EQUAL
address
3HtHEcnWqh6ZYApP6aMeWEWhV6ZrEf9tQw
transaction
89a2cce59ad2091ffe44a8639b4da15b456eddff696e2f97833af34e0ef4af4f
spent
true